domain
简明释义
英[dəˈmeɪn;dəʊˈmeɪn]美[doʊˈmeɪn]
n. 领域,范围;领土,势力范围;(因特网上的)域;(函数的)定义域;地产
【名】 (Domain)(英、法)多曼(人名)
复 数 d o m a i n s

例句
1.Avoid redundancy: Define an item in the glossary or in the domain model, but not in both.
避免冗余:在术语表或域模型中定义一个条目,但是不要在两者里面都下定义。
2.An Internet society spokeswoman said.org domain users will not experience any disruptions during the transition.
一位互联网协会的女发言人说,在这次过渡中,域名为的用户不会受到任何影响。
3.Reading gives you the possibility to speak about science, even if you don't work in this domain.
阅读让你有机会谈论你哪怕没有接触过的领域,比如科学方面的内容。
4.From the profusion of electronic-text sites available, it looks as if this virtual library is here to stay unless a proposed revision to copyright law takes many publications out of the public domain.
从现有的大量电子文本网站来看,除非版权法的修订提案将许多出版物排除在公共领域之外,否则这个虚拟图书馆似乎将继续存在。
5.The ancestors of the modern Zuni and Hopi built and then, for reasons still mysterious, abandoned the complex roads and structures of the domain they ruled a millennium ago in the American southwest.
一千年前在美国西南部,现代祖尼人和霍皮人的祖先在他们统治的土地上修建了复杂的道路和建筑,后来由于一些不为人所知的原因,又遗弃了这些复杂的道路和建筑。
6.DNS refers to the Domain Name System, which is a directory that connects names to numerical Internet addresses.
DNS指的是域名系统,它是一个目录,将名称连接到数字互联网地址。
7.The system login uses information such as source ID (SID), domain and system user name for authentication, so it is considered secure.
系统登录会使用到诸如源ID(安全识别符),域和系统用户名等信息进行身份验证,因此被认为是安全的。
